Michael Bryant Williams

 

Michael Bryant Williams, affectionately known as “Mikey” was born in Kansas City, Kansas, September 29, 1962.   His parents were Bryant Eugene Cunningham and Bessie Young Williams, both which preceded him in death.

Mikey attended schools in Kansas City, Kansas graduating from Wyandotte High School in 1980.  After graduation, he went to Emporia to pursue his dreams, perfecting his gift in the culinary arts.   He worked for several area restaurants until he was unable to work due to his health.    His illness didn’t stop him from cooking, but it stopped others from tasting real good food!

 At an early age he was baptized at the Pleasant Green Baptist Church.   He re-dedicated his life to Christ, April 24, 2014, at the Beauty of Holiness New Testament Pentecostal Church.  

Mikey married the former Jennifer Wycoff.  The marriage was dissolved.   He later became friends with Peggy Jacobs.   A blended family of children was formed between the relationships:   David, Danielle, Jessica, Jared, Jeremy and Joshual. 

Mikey joined his parents, and sister, Kimberly in heaven, November 15, 2015. 

He leaves to cherish his memories, his children:  David (Micah) Williams; Danielle Williams, Jessica Jacobs, Jared, Jeremy and Joshua Jacobs; his siblings:  Anthony (Trina) Williams, Travis Williams, Felicia (Lawrence) Nelson, DeLora (William) Vanoy, Crystal Donnell and Marsha Meggerson; his grandchildren:  Isaiah Michael, Caroline Gray, Rhett Bryant, Stevie, JaNiyah, Jayveon; a fraternal uncle, Willie Cunningham, and a maternal aunt, Helen Young Gee; and a host of nieces and nephews, cousins and friends.  

Mikey was well-loved and was the rock of our lives.   He was a joy to his siblings and children.
